How to Make a Portfolio Website Using HTML and CSS


hey everyone hope you all fine, today we are going to learn how to make a portfolio website using HTML and CSS. I’ve designed a complete single-page responsive website using HTML, CSS, and JavaScript.

Inside the website has a bunch of features that will help you to improve your HTML, and CSS skills, also you will learn how to use JS to manipulate the content inside the website such as changing the text after 5 seconds, and also have many cool animations inside the website.

Are you looking to make an impressive portfolio website but don’t know how to get started? You can easily learn HTML and CSS and build your own professional website.

In this guide, we will walk through the step-by-step process for creating a stunning portfolio website.

Creating a portfolio website is an important step in establishing your online presence and showcasing your work. A portfolio website not only helps to present a professional image, it can also provide helpful information about your skills and experience.

It’s possible to create a portfolio website using HTML and CSS, even if you don’t have programming experience. In this tutorial, we’ll walk through the process of building a basic portfolio website with HTML and CSS.

We will create a simple grid-style layout and then add content, styling, links to external pages, and further customization.

Following these steps will give you an attractive, functional site that helps you put your best foot forward for potential employers or clients. Ready? Let’s get started!

How to Make a Portfolio Website Using HTML and CSS

Creating a portfolio website is an essential first step in putting yourself out there as a professional. It not only serves to introduce you to potential employers, clients, and customers, but also allows you to showcase your skills, accomplishments, and passions. Here are some of the key benefits of having a portfolio website:

Enhances your professional image: Creating a polished portfolio website will help establish yourself as a serious business or artist. Having your own URL also lends credibility to your projects and services and helps you stand out from the crowd.

Easily updated: Adding new work or updating existing projects on your portfolio site is easy and doesn’t require any programming knowledge. You can keep track of all the changes you make in one central place for future reference.

SEO friendly: When creating a portfolio website with HTML and CSS, you have more control over how search engines view it. For example, you can adjust meta tags like title tags that help Google better index and rank your pages on their search results.

Interactive design: Leveraging HTML and CSS allows for interactive elements like galleries or audio recordings that create an engaging experience for users on any device.

With the right combination of HTML and CSS knowledge, anyone can create a truly unique website that showcases their work in the best possible light – no development experience needed!

Prerequisites for Creating a Portfolio Website

Before you can begin to create a portfolio website, there are several prerequisites that need to be met. You will need a basic understanding of HTML and CSS coding, as well as an understanding of web hosting. Once these skills and knowledge have been obtained, then you can begin the process of creating a portfolio website.

Beginning with HTML, learning the basics of markup language provides the foundation for any website project. Students can gain this knowledge through taking coding classes, reading tutorials online, or just simply fiddling around with code in their text editor.

Once the basics have been mastered, you should progress to looking at common web design patterns as these will help you create a unique look and feel for your own portfolio site. You can also use CSS pre-processors such as Sass and Less to add even more custom styling potential to your projects. There are tons of online resources available to help guide you in using pre-processors correctly.

Lastly, it is important that your basic understanding of hosting is solid too – so before working on your portfolio site make sure you are familiar with setting up server environments. Having a good handle on how websites get from Point A (your computer) to Point B (the internet) will go a long way in helping you troubleshoot issues within your project quickly and effectively as they come up!

Portfolio Website Using HTML and CSS Steps

Creating a portfolio website is one of the best ways to show off your best work and impress potential employers or clients. It allows you to easily create a professional-looking site that showcases all the great things you’ve done, including projects, publications, skills, and more. Fortunately, creating a portfolio website is not as hard or intimidating as it sounds. Here are the steps to get started:

Set up your HTML files: Once you have an idea of what content will go on which pages, start setting up the files that will contain each page’s HTML markup – either by hand or using an automated tool such as Bootstrap – making sure to include proper titles and headings throughout to ensure good SEO rankings when people search for keywords relating to your business or interests online.

Add styling with CSS: Make sure each page looks its best by adding style through CSS classes on each element (or tag) within the HTML code that you set up earlier with external style sheets linked from within each HTML file (keep them organized with subfolders). Do this for every piece of content at all different screen sizes!

Test it out: Finally, make sure everything works properly across multiple browsers (i.e., Chrome, Safari etc.) by actually testing every element in different windows sizes on multiple devices if possible (computers & phones). This will also help you make any remaining tweaks as needed before going live or sharing with others!

How to create a portfolio website using HTML and CSS only?

When designing the layout of your portfolio website, there are a few important points to consider. The main goal for your online portfolio should be to make it easy for visitors to find the information they need quickly and in an organized manner.

You also want your portfolio website to reflect your skillset and make use of white space, design elements and colors that will keep visitors engaged while they browse through the different sections. To do this you’ll need to plan out how you want each page in your portfolio website to look.

Start by looking at the key features that you would like to include on each page of your website. Some important elements on a portfolio page may include:

You May Also Like:

a header with navigation, a featured area with images or videos, categories of work samples or text, contact information, social media links and more. All these elements should work together in harmony as well as create balance throughout the overall design of your website.

Once you’ve identified key features in each page you can start designing using HTML and CSS. HTML is typically used for structure while CSS adds simple styling such as text size and color. When considering how each element should appear such as font size or color palette choose something that resonates with your personal brand rather than just following what’s popular trend at the time. It’s important that whatever design choices you make represent who you are and represent your works in the best way possible across various devices (e.g., mobile phones tablets etc.).

Creating the HTML Structure

Creating the HTML structure for a portfolio website is an important step in the development process. A solid HTML framework will make it easier to design and build a strong portfolio website.

To get started, open up your favorite code editor and create a new file called “index.html”. This will be the main page of your website. Once you have created the file, type in “” as the first line of code before beginning your HTML structure. This defines your page as an HTML document to browsers and search engines.

Next, you will need to define an html element which is done like this: “”. Defining this element allows browsers and search engines to determine which language is used on your page (in this case, English). After that, begin creating the document structure with familiar elements such as head and body tags.

The head element should contain information about your site such as a short title, importing external stylesheets (CSS) files, or placing scripts/libraries needed for functionality such as JavaScript or jQuery. The body element should include content sections such as a header (navigation bar if included), main content area, and footer with copyright information or space for links to social media accounts. To divide these sections further you can use such elements as the header, each section, article, header, footer elements, etc..

Once you have set up the basic structure, you​ can begin styling these elements using Cascading Style Sheets (CSS).

Styling the Portfolio Website using CSS

Writing code for a website is one thing, styling it is another. With HTML and CSS combined, you can transform your dull and basic portfolio website into something that looks unique and professional. With CSS, you can define the look and feel of your site using the color scheme, typography, images, backgrounds, borders, and dimensions of HTML elements.

To create a visually appealing portfolio website using CSS, there are various properties that can be used to alter its look and feel. These include:

-Colors: The colors used on a webpage are defined in the web page’s style sheet (CSS file). This gives you control over what colors appear on the page as well as defining text sizes/widths/heights and font styles.

-Typography: Typographical elements will help add visual interest to your portfolio site according to your design needs. Different fonts sizes can be used to draw attention to certain items while different font styles and gravities guide users through your page’s visual hierarchy.

-Images: Images are important elements that can play an influential role in terms of displaying content or setting the overall tone for a design. For example, images can be used for navigation or as background images to create patterns or shapes within a layout.

-Backgrounds & Borders: You have control over backgrounds by adding gradients or solid color blocks behind either individual or multiple elements depending on how visually complex you want to make it—or rather let it remain quite simple with just one blended background color throughout the entire page layout if desired! Additionally borders between separate columns of content acts as natural compositional breakups which help organize information into easily digestible chunks making reading websites easier on eyes too!

-Dimensions & Spacing: Creating white space (adding padding) between pieces of content helps with organizing information in an orderly way—avoiding putting all text elements directly adjacent against each other unless there is an intentionally desired effect as having them in close proximity makes them easily double accessible at once! Adding margins around paragraphs that break up their respective blocks also creates subtle distinctions throughout different parts of the website ultimately leaving more room available overall so highlighting important areas within content stands out more clearly than others on screen!

Finalizing the Portfolio Website

Once the HTML and CSS have been written and tested, the user can move on to finalizing the website. To do this, the user should ensure that all necessary files—such as images, documents, and additional CSS files—are included in the correct locations. The user might also decide to add new features or make changes to syntax if desired. It is important that all of these changes are tested thoroughly before uploading them onto a live server. Once finalized, the portfolio website should function and display properly on multiple browsers and platforms.

The complete portfolio website will contain multiple elements such as styled and organized titles, meta tags for Google optimization, favicon declarations, styling adjustments for mobile devices, and dozens of other small details that a web developer needs to be aware of for a successful launch into production. With creative coding abilities as well as a dedication to meticulous testing standards and QA maintenance, any portfolio website should be ready to go soon!

this tutorial is all about How to Make a Portfolio Website Using HTML and CSS, hope you’ve learned many new things from this tutorial. If you’ve any questions or suggestions feel free to contact me thanks..


Please enter your comment!
Please enter your name here

This site uses Akismet to reduce spam. Learn how your comment data is processed.